# Ways to use Channels

Channels provides Account-scoped messaging for people and agents. Choose the interface that fits how you work, and confirm the Account before reading or sending messages.

## Choose an interface

| Interface        | Use it when                                                                               | Next step                                                     |
| ---------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Channels for Mac | You want to read conversations, reply in threads, and manage messages in a native app.    | [Install Channels](/docs/channels/get-started/first-message). |
| Socra CLI        | You want to inspect Channels resources from a terminal or a runtime with terminal access. | [Use the Channels CLI](/docs/channels/reference/cli).         |

Both interfaces use Account permissions. Signing into one Account does not grant access to another Account's conversations.
